package tv.dyndns.kishibe.qmaclone.client.game.judge;
import static org.junit.Assert.assertFalse;
import static org.junit.Assert.assertTrue;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.junit.runners.JUnit4;
import tv.dyndns.kishibe.qmaclone.client.constant.Constant;
import com.google.common.base.Joiner;
@RunWith(JUnit4.class)
public class JudgeJunbanTest extends JudgeTestBase {
private JudgeJunban judge;
@Before
public void setUp() throws Exception {
super.setUp();
judge = new JudgeJunban();
problem.numberOfDisplayedChoices = 4;
}
@Test
public void judgeShouldReturnFalseIfNoAnswer() {
String playerAnswer = "";
assertFalse(judge.judge(problem, playerAnswer));
}
@Test
public void judgeShouldReturnFalseIfTimeUp() {
String playerAnswer = null;
assertFalse(judge.judge(problem, playerAnswer));
}
@Test
public void judgeShouldReturnTrueIfCorrect() {
problem.shuffledAnswers = toArray("a", "b", "c", "d");
String playerAnswer = Joiner.on(Constant.DELIMITER_GENERAL).join("a", "b", "c", "d");
assertTrue(judge.judge(problem, playerAnswer));
}
@Test
public void judgeShouldReturnFalseIfIncorrect() {
problem.shuffledAnswers = toArray("a", "b", "c", "d");
String playerAnswer = Joiner.on(Constant.DELIMITER_GENERAL).join("a", "c", "b", "d");
assertFalse(judge.judge(problem, playerAnswer));
}
@Test
public void judgeShouldReturnTrueIfCorrectWith3Choices() {
problem.shuffledAnswers = toArray("a", "b", "c");
problem.numberOfDisplayedChoices = 3;
String playerAnswer = Joiner.on(Constant.DELIMITER_GENERAL).join("a", "b", "c");
assertTrue(judge.judge(problem, playerAnswer));
}
@Test
public void judgeShouldReturnFalseIfIncorrectWith3Choices() {
problem.shuffledAnswers = toArray("a", "b", "c", "d");
problem.numberOfDisplayedChoices = 3;
String playerAnswer = Joiner.on(Constant.DELIMITER_GENERAL).join("a", "c", "b");
assertFalse(judge.judge(problem, playerAnswer));
}
}
